Sanitary Conveniences.
The following Conveniences come under the supervision of the Public
Health Department:—
The Green Convenience.—Has been enlarged during the year.
Church Street Convenience.—Continues to serve the district in its immediate
vicinity, but there does not seem to be the demand here that
one would expect in such an area.
Angel Road Convenience.—Has been removed from the centre of the
road and is being rebuilt on the side walk just removed from the
corner.
The erection of two additional Conveniences was commenced during the
year at Victoria Road and the Sunken Gardens, Bush Hill Park.
